A major breakthrough in sensor technology designed for detecting oxygen contamination in ‘ultra high purity’ industrial gases.
- Sensitivity: < 0.25 ppb or < 250 ppt
- Stability: < 1 ppb over temperature fluctuations of + 10º F
- Low range: 0-100 ppb full scale
- Response time 90% of full scale: < 60 seconds
- Recovery: To 1 ppb from 5 minute exposure to 1 ppm in 30 minutes
- Calibration intervals: 2-3 months with no maintenance
- Expected life: 15 months under normal conditions
